The Eaton through-beam photoelectric sensor from The Eaton offers robust performance and reliability in a compact design. Engineered for precision in detection, this sensor operates within a wide voltage range and is ideal for automated applications requiring efficient sensing capabilities. The sleek stainless-steel construct enhances durability, making it perfect for harsh environments. With features like short-circuit protection and excellent shock resistance, it is designed to maintain operational integrity even in challenging conditions. This product ensures superior functionality with its light-switching principle, making it suitable for diverse industrial settings. Whether utilized in manufacturing or assembly lines, it delivers precise detection while offering easy installation via its connector interface.

Features a high sensing distance for versatile applications
Constructed from stainless steel for enhanced longevity
Equipped with a straightforward plug-in connection for simplified setup
Includes built-in short-circuit protection for added safety
Offers a high switching frequency, ensuring quick response times
Designed to withstand extreme temperatures for reliable operation
Delivers real-time status indication with a clear LED
Includes protection against wire breakage to prevent downtime
